Code Quality Standards Skill

This skill covers quality gates and enforcement for TypeScript projects.

When to Use

Use this skill when:

  • Defining quality standards
  • Setting up quality gates
  • Reviewing code quality
  • Configuring CI/CD quality checks

Core Principle

ZERO WARNINGS POLICY - All warnings are treated as errors. No exceptions without documented justification.

Quality Gates

Required Checks (Must Pass)

CheckCommandRequirement
Type Checknpm run type-checkZero errors
Lintingnpm run lintZero errors, zero warnings
Formattingnpm run format:checkAll files formatted
Testsnpm testAll tests pass

Recommended Checks

CheckCommandRequirement
Coveragenpm run test:coverage80% minimum
Securitynpm auditNo high/critical
LicensesLicense checkApproved licenses only

Package.json Scripts

json
{
  "scripts": {
    "type-check": "tsc --noEmit",
    "lint": "biome check .",
    "lint:fix": "biome check --write .",
    "format": "biome format --write .",
    "format:check": "biome format .",
    "test": "vitest run",
    "test:coverage": "vitest run --coverage",
    "validate": "npm run type-check && npm run lint && npm run format:check && npm test",
    "pre-commit": "lint-staged && npm run type-check"
  }
}

Type Safety Standards

Required TypeScript Configuration

json
{
  "compilerOptions": {
    "strict": true,
    "noImplicitAny": true,
    "noUncheckedIndexedAccess": true
  }
}

Forbidden Patterns

typescript
// ❌ Never use any
function bad(data: any) { }
const x: any = value;

// ❌ No implicit any
function bad(data) { }  // Error: implicit any

// ❌ No @ts-ignore without justification
// @ts-ignore
riskyCode();

// ✅ Acceptable with justification
// @ts-expect-error - External library has incorrect types (issue #123)
externalLib.brokenMethod();

Linting Standards

Biome Configuration

json
{
  "linter": {
    "rules": {
      "recommended": true,
      "suspicious": {
        "noExplicitAny": "error"
      },
      "correctness": {
        "noUnusedVariables": "error"
      }
    }
  }
}

ESLint Configuration

typescript
{
  rules: {
    '@typescript-eslint/no-explicit-any': 'error',
    '@typescript-eslint/no-unused-vars': 'error',
    '@typescript-eslint/explicit-function-return-type': 'error',
  }
}

Code Style Standards

Naming Conventions

typescript
// Variables: camelCase
const userName = 'Alice';
const isActive = true;

// Constants: UPPER_SNAKE_CASE
const MAX_RETRIES = 3;
const API_BASE_URL = 'https://api.example.com';

// Functions: camelCase
function calculateTotal() { }
const processData = () => { };

// Classes: PascalCase
class UserService { }
class ApiClient { }

// Interfaces/Types: PascalCase
interface UserData { }
type ApiResponse<T> = { };

// Enums: PascalCase with PascalCase values
enum Status {
  Active = 'ACTIVE',
  Inactive = 'INACTIVE',
}

File Naming

code
src/
├── components/
│   ├── Button.tsx           # PascalCase for components
│   └── user-profile.tsx     # kebab-case acceptable
├── utils/
│   └── format-date.ts       # kebab-case for utilities
├── services/
│   └── api-client.ts        # kebab-case for services
└── types/
    └── user.ts              # lowercase for type files

Test Standards

Test File Location

code
src/
├── utils/
│   ├── format.ts
│   └── __tests__/
│       └── format.test.ts

Test Structure

typescript
describe('FunctionName', () => {
  describe('when condition', () => {
    it('should do expected behavior', () => {
      // Arrange
      // Act
      // Assert
    });
  });
});

Coverage Requirements

  • Lines: 80% minimum
  • Functions: 80% minimum
  • Branches: 80% minimum
  • Statements: 80% minimum

Documentation Standards

Required Documentation

typescript
/**
 * Brief description of the function.
 *
 * @param input - Description of input parameter
 * @returns Description of return value
 * @throws {ErrorType} Description of when thrown
 *
 * @example
 * ```typescript
 * const result = functionName('input');
 * ```
 */
export function functionName(input: string): Result {
  // implementation
}

When Documentation Required

  • All exported functions
  • All exported classes
  • All exported interfaces
  • Complex internal logic

CI/CD Quality Pipeline

yaml
name: Quality Checks

on: [push, pull_request]

jobs:
  quality:
    runs-on: ubuntu-latest
    steps:
      - uses: actions/checkout@v4

      - uses: actions/setup-node@v4
        with:
          node-version: '22'
          cache: 'npm'

      - run: npm ci

      - name: Type Check
        run: npm run type-check

      - name: Lint
        run: npm run lint

      - name: Format Check
        run: npm run format:check

      - name: Test
        run: npm run test:coverage

      - name: Security Audit
        run: npm audit --audit-level=high

Quality Metrics

Code Health Indicators

MetricGoodWarningCritical
Type Errors0>0>0
Lint Warnings01-5>5
Test Coverage>80%60-80%<60%
Vulnerabilities0 high0 criticalAny critical

Monitoring Quality

bash
# Generate quality report
npm run validate

# Check specific metrics
npm run type-check  # Type errors
npm run lint        # Lint issues
npm run test:coverage  # Coverage percentage
npm audit           # Vulnerabilities

Exceptions Process

When Exceptions Allowed

  1. External library type issues
  2. Generated code
  3. Legacy code (with migration plan)
  4. Platform-specific code

Exception Documentation

typescript
// File: src/legacy/old-module.ts
// QUALITY EXCEPTION: Legacy code pending migration
// Issue: #456
// Owner: @developer
// Review Date: 2024-06-01

/* eslint-disable @typescript-eslint/no-explicit-any */
// Legacy code here
/* eslint-enable @typescript-eslint/no-explicit-any */

Best Practices Summary

  1. Zero warnings - All warnings are errors
  2. Type everything - No implicit or explicit any
  3. Test everything - 80% coverage minimum
  4. Document exports - Public API documented
  5. Automate checks - CI/CD enforces standards
  6. Review exceptions - Track and expire
  7. Consistent style - Automated formatting

Code Review Checklist

  • Type check passes with zero errors
  • Lint passes with zero warnings
  • Code is properly formatted
  • Tests pass with 80%+ coverage
  • No new security vulnerabilities
  • Public API documented
  • Exceptions documented with issues
